Octomore Edition 07.1

Octomore Edition 07.1
Whisky Octomore Edition 07.1
Country Scotland
Region Islay
Type Single Malt
Cask American Oak
Age 5 years old
Abv 59.5%
Rating 88/100

About

The Islay-based Bruichladdich Distillery was opened in 1881, but their current product range is the result of the Jim McEwan-led revival of the early 2000's. Rémy Cointreau acquired Bruichladdich in 2012.

says on April 8, 2018
Would you buy this again? Yes
Rating: 97/100
Finish strength: Very long
Color: Gin clear

General description

first smell of heavy smoke, tar. fruity taste, dried fruits, oily. hold it in your mouth for at least 20 seconds to make all the flavours come free. it will numb your tongue and enhance the sweet flavours. long aftertaste of salty caramel with a peated undertone.

Nose

tar and peat but with some sulfury smells. almost gluey

Palate

first lots of peat, then when kept in mouth for 20 seconds it will numb your tongue and bring free all sweet, dried fruits and caramel flavours

Finish

salty caramel with a peated undertone.
